Dated cabinets

 

If you have the dark wood that was popular during the 1970s, the best option is to paint the wood an off-white or white, depending on the style of your house.  This will immediately make your bathroom feel bigger and more current. 

I like Swiss Coffee by Benjamin Moore. Then add brushed nickel, wrought iron or oiled bronze handles or pulls. 

 

Dated cabinets that are damaged and non repairable

 

If they are in a guest bathroom or smaller bathroom, consider replacing it with a pedestal sink if your budget allows for it.  The idea is to make the bathroom feel spacious and look current.  Buyers love pedestal sinks.  I find that they work well in a guest bathroom, where cabinet space is not as important.
